Western Province do the double at the Governor’s Cup

  • 5

The Western Province Women and Men emerged victorious at the Inter-Provincial Rugby 7’s Governor’s Cup Played Today (18th Nov) at Racecourse Grounds.

Nine teams from the nine Provinces took part as they went head-on from 8 a.m., seeking to display dominance over their opponents. 

The Bowl was won by the Southern for the Women while the Northern Province secured the title for the Men.

In the cup Final, it was Central Province taking on the Western Province as the two power-house provinces went head-on in both the Men’s and Women’s segments. 

Women’s Cup Final 

Western Province were simply unstoppable as first speedster Ishani Perera opened the scoring with a couple of tries on the far touchline, putting Western Province in charge going into lemons, leading 24-00. 

It was more of the same in the second half for Western Province as they pummeled over the Central Province Women, thanks to a great show by Theekshana Liyanage.  

She ended with two tries as the Western Province ended in commanding fashion, conceding no points. The final score read 38-00. 

Men’s Cup Final 

The Men’s final was a more competitive, balanced game, as both teams looked equally strong coming into the game. 

Western Province opened the scoring off the game’s very first play, but Central did not capitulate, holding on. On the stroke of half time, Central Province scored taking things even into the break, 7-points all. 

It was Central Province who scored first in the second half as they grabbed a surprise lead after staying in the game. 

With time running out on the Westerners, Aaron Joshua stepped up as the young winger put on a dazzling turn of pace following a sublime double step, bamboozling the on-rushing defender to score and help Western Province strike back.  

Moments later, a third try was scored by the Westerners as they downed Central Province in a gripping final to take home the double, winning the Men’s and Women’s segments. 

Full time: Western Province 19-12 Central Province 

Players of the tournament  

Men’s Segment – Manula Rathnayake (Western Province) 
Women’s Segment – Subashini Saumya (Western Province)
